对象存储有哪些协议,对象存储协议详解,技术原理与应用场景
- 综合资讯
- 2024-11-16 23:59:49
- 0
对象存储协议包括HTTP(S 、RESTful API等,主要基于RESTful架构,通过HTTP请求实现对象存储服务。技术原理上,对象存储将数据划分为对象,并通过唯一...
对象存储协议包括HTTP(S)、RESTful API等,主要基于RESTful架构,通过HTTP请求实现对象存储服务。技术原理上,对象存储将数据划分为对象,并通过唯一标识符进行管理。应用场景广泛,如云存储、大数据、CDN等,提供高效、可扩展的数据存储解决方案。
随着互联网技术的飞速发展,数据量呈爆炸式增长,传统的文件存储方式已无法满足海量数据的存储需求,对象存储作为一种新兴的存储技术,因其高效、灵活、可扩展等特点,逐渐成为企业数据存储的首选方案,本文将详细介绍对象存储的协议,包括其技术原理和应用场景。
对象存储协议概述
对象存储协议是指用于实现对象存储服务的通信协议,主流的对象存储协议有如下几种:
1、Amazon S3协议
Amazon S3(Simple Storage Service)是亚马逊云服务提供的一种对象存储服务,其协议成为对象存储领域的标准,S3协议主要包括以下内容:
(1)HTTP/HTTPS协议:S3服务通过HTTP/HTTPS协议与客户端进行通信,客户端可以使用curl、Postman等工具进行访问。
(2)RESTful API:S3协议采用RESTful API设计,支持标准HTTP方法,如GET、PUT、POST、DELETE等。
(3)Bucket和Object:S3中的数据存储在Bucket中,Bucket是存储空间的容器,Object是存储在Bucket中的单个文件。
2、OpenStack Swift协议
OpenStack Swift是开源的对象存储系统,其协议主要包括以下内容:
(1)HTTP/HTTPS协议:Swift服务通过HTTP/HTTPS协议与客户端进行通信。
(2)RESTful API:Swift协议采用RESTful API设计,支持标准HTTP方法。
(3)Container和Object:Swift中的数据存储在Container中,Container是存储空间的容器,Object是存储在Container中的单个文件。
3、Ceph协议
Ceph是一个开源的对象存储系统,其协议主要包括以下内容:
(1)Rados协议:Ceph使用Rados协议进行数据存储,Rados协议是一种基于librados库的协议。
(2)RadosGW:Ceph的RadosGW(Rados Gateway)模块负责处理客户端的HTTP请求,将请求转换为Rados协议请求。
4、MinIO协议
MinIO是一个开源的对象存储系统,其协议主要包括以下内容:
(1)HTTP/HTTPS协议:MinIO服务通过HTTP/HTTPS协议与客户端进行通信。
(2)RESTful API:MinIO协议采用RESTful API设计,支持标准HTTP方法。
(3)Bucket和Object:MinIO中的数据存储在Bucket中,Bucket是存储空间的容器,Object是存储在Bucket中的单个文件。
对象存储协议技术原理
1、数据存储
对象存储协议通过将数据划分为多个对象,将对象存储在分布式存储系统中,每个对象包含数据、元数据和元数据索引,数据存储过程如下:
(1)客户端将数据、元数据和元数据索引打包成一个对象。
(2)客户端将对象发送到对象存储系统。
(3)对象存储系统将对象存储在分布式存储系统中,并将对象信息存储在元数据索引中。
2、数据检索
客户端通过以下步骤检索数据:
(1)客户端向对象存储系统发送请求,指定要检索的对象。
(2)对象存储系统根据元数据索引查找对象存储位置。
(3)对象存储系统将对象发送给客户端。
3、数据备份与容错
对象存储协议通过以下方式实现数据备份与容错:
(1)数据冗余:对象存储系统将数据复制到多个节点,提高数据可靠性。
(2)数据校验:对象存储系统对数据进行校验,确保数据一致性。
(3)数据恢复:当发生数据损坏时,对象存储系统可以从备份中恢复数据。
对象存储协议应用场景
1、大数据存储
对象存储协议适用于大数据存储场景,如日志存储、视频存储、图片存储等。
2、云计算平台
对象存储协议是云计算平台的重要组成部分,如阿里云、腾讯云等。
3、物联网
对象存储协议适用于物联网场景,如设备数据存储、视频监控等。
4、云备份与恢复
对象存储协议可以实现云备份与恢复,提高企业数据安全性。
对象存储协议作为一种新兴的存储技术,具有高效、灵活、可扩展等特点,本文介绍了对象存储协议的技术原理和应用场景,旨在为读者提供更深入的了解,随着技术的不断发展,对象存储协议将在更多领域发挥重要作用。
本文链接:https://www.zhitaoyun.cn/870702.html
发表评论